We all love our pets, but do we really understand them or see the world from their perspective? Join UK-based vets, Dr Maggie Roberts and Dr Vanessa Howie for their must-listen podcast made especially for pet caregivers. They are highly experienced vets who have worked in both companion animal vet practice and the animal charity sector and provide insight into all aspects of pet ownership.

Maggie and Vanessa are passionate about animal welfare and love to share their knowledge in a down to earth, humorous but compassionate way. No pet subject is out of bounds, and they are happy to tackle difficult and controversial topics as well as offering practical advice for anyone already owning a pet or thinking about welcoming one into their home.

  • Episode 14: From Egyptian gods to a myriad of moggies – a history of cat breeds
    2026/08/19

    Cats were once worshipped as gods and they’ve never forgotten it! But why did the Egyptians love cats so much and what part did they play in their domestication? Vanessa and Maggie delve into the history of how cats came to be such a widespread form of rodent control and then much-loved pets. They were already excellent hunters and clean, affectionate pets that didn’t need to be modified for human use so why did the Victorians want to develop different cat breeds? We chat about these moggie mysteries and discuss the growing number of cat breeds.

  • Episode 13: Having a whale of a time? How to interact with wild animals in a welfare-friendly way
    2026/08/05

    As animal lovers, there is nothing better than seeing animals in their natural habitats. Sadly, we don’t always get the opportunities to do this but there are other ways of interacting with wild animals including visiting zoos, aquaria, conservation projects or even getting a mobile animal exhibitor to visit your school or party. But what is the animal’s experience? Maggie and Vanessa discuss their views on which types of activities should be avoided, how to choose more animal-friendly ones and share some of their own experiences, both good and bad.

  • Episode 12: Animal Activities – are they good or bad for animal welfare?
    2026/07/22

    With summer holidays on the horizon, many people will be looking for activities to engage in. Animal lovers may be tempted by the array of animal-related activities available but how can we be sure that the animals’ welfare is put first? In this episode Vanessa and Maggie discuss activities involving domestic species such as bulls, horses, donkeys and camels. Is it OK to ride an elephant or trek with llamas? What about cat cafes and goat yoga? We will give you our views and some tips to check if your chosen activity is OK from the animal’s perspective.
